Smallwood Primary School and Language unit is a one form entry school with 258 pupils currently on role, including a resource base with 45 pupils. Our recent Ofsted inspection (2022) graded it a ‘Good’ school, highlighting: ‘pupils enjoy coming to school and are safe’, ‘“Teachers are encouraging. They have high aspirations for all pupils and make it possible for them to succeed in their learning”.
